Problem solving
Blade set is cutting badly or pulling hair out.
Cause: Blade set is dirty or worn out.
f Clean and oil the blade set; if this does not resolve the problem,
replace the blade set.
Skin injury
Cause: Too much pressure on the skin.
de
f Reduce pressure when cutting close to skin.
en
Cause: Damaged blade set.
f Check whether the blade edges were damaged during use and replace
fr
the blade set if necessary.
it
Battery operating time is too short
es
Cause: A blade set that is very dirty and has not been oiled can reduce the
available battery operating time substantially!
pt
f Clean and oil the blade set thoroughly. If the blade set is clean and
nl
oiled and the battery operating time is still far too short, it is likely that
the batteries are nearing the end of their life.
da
Cause: Battery power indicator is imprecise.
sv
f Fully discharge the appliance before fully recharging it in one uninter-
rupted charging process.
no
Battery charge indicator light does not light up
fi
Cause: Appliance has not been correctly placed on the charging stand.
tr
f Ensure that the hand-held appliance has been correctly placed on the
charging stand.
pl
Cause: Appliance socket is dirty.
cs
f Clean the appliance socket.
sk
Cause: Defective power supply.
hr
f Make sure that there is a faultless contact between the plug-in trans-
former and the socket.
hu
f Check the mains cable for possible damage.
sl
Entire battery power indicator is flashing
ro
f Check whether the blade set is blocked and the blade is able to move.
Switch the appliance off and back on. If the entire display is flashing,
bg
please contact your specialist retailer or a WAHL service centre.
ru
In the event that this information does not help you resolve your problem,
uk
please contact our service centre. Never attempt to repair the appliance
yourself!

Disposal
Handle with care! Environmental damage in the event of
incorrect disposal.
f Discharge batteries prior to disposal!
f Correct disposal will ensure environmental protection and
prevent any potentially harmful impact on people and the
environment.
Adhere to the relevant legal requirements when disposing of the appliance.
Information on the disposal of electrical and electronic appliances in
the European Community:
Within the European Community, national regulations are
specified for the disposal of electrical appliances, based on EU
Waste Electrical and Electronic Equipment Directive 2012/19/EC
(WEEE). In accordance with this, the appliance can no longer be
disposed of with the local or domestic waste.The appliance will
be accepted free of charge by local collection points or recycling
centres. The packaging for this product is made from recyclable
materials. Dispose of this in an environmentally friendly manner
by recycling it.
